Stephan Talty
Talty delves into the complexities of espionage and cultural identity, using narrative nonfiction and crime fiction to illuminate these themes. His books often delve into pivotal historical events and figures, bringing them to life through meticulous research and engaging storytelling. In works like "Agent Garbo: The Brilliant, Eccentric Double Agent who Tricked Hitler and Saved D-Day," Talty uncovers the hidden intricacies of espionage that shaped major historical turning points. Meanwhile, his Abbie Kearney crime novels, such as "Black Irish," explore the gritty realities of urban life and justice.\n\nTalty’s method blends thorough research with vivid narratives, making history and complex subjects accessible to a wide audience. This approach is evident in titles like "Empire of Blue Water: Captain Morgan’s Great Pirate Army, the Epic Battle for the Americas, and the Catastrophe that Ended the Outlaw’s Reign," where he reconstructs historical episodes with clarity and depth.
